POSITION SUMMARY The Test Engineer aids in the direction of designing, developing, and implementing cost-effective methods of testing and troubleshooting systems and equipment for performance and safety evaluations. The Test Engineer gives guidance to preparing test and diagnostic programs, designing test fixtures and equipment, and completes setups and calibrations for equipment. The Electrical Design Engineer plans necessary steps required for testing and evaluating products.

* Description for Internal Candidates

RESPONSIBILITIES

  • Work with Lab Supervisor to direct Test Technicians as needed in daily activity including job assignments and expectation of completion.
  • Work closely with design engineering group to ensure test procedures/data meets expectations.
  • Reviews test progress and evaluates results.
  • Perform required presentations utilizing automated test equipment for customer visits.
  • Perform test validations.
  • Perform lab instrumentation calibrations within the lab.
  • Provide continuous support to engineering and support groups in order to provide internal and external customers with outstanding final quality test products.

QUALIFICATIONS

Requirements

  • Minimum of 2-3 years’ experience in thermal systems testing. Other equivalent combinations of education and hands on experience may be considered.
  • Knowledge of Vertiv Thermal Management Products preferred.
  • Thorough knowledge of psychometrics, vapor compression refrigeration cycle, and their methods of test.
  • Knowledge of 3-Phase electrical circuits.
  • Thorough knowledge of networks including Ethernet and serial coms.
  • Knowledge of digital and electronic circuitry.
  • Ability to configure data acquisition systems.
  • Ability to use temperature and pressure measurement instruments.
  • Ability to use standard electrical instruments.
  • Ability to read and interpret industry test standards.
  • Ability to read and interpret product schematics.
  • Ability to be hands-on with products to troubleshoot and diagnose issues.
  • Leadership and communication skills. Ability to give direction to Test Technicians & communicate test issues to all levels of management.
  • Excellent communication skills with a professional attitude towards customer relations.
  • Self-directed, good problem-solving skills.
  • Bachelor’s degree in mechanical engineering with thermal / fluid sciences emphasis or equivalent degree.
